What does a Director RFP Analyst do?

A Director RFP Analyst leads and manages the process of responding to Requests for Proposals (RFPs) from potential clients or partners. This role involves coordinating cross-functional teams to gather necessary information, ensuring the proposal meets client requirements, and delivering compelling, compliant submissions on time. The director also develops strategies to improve win rates, streamlines RFP processes, and often oversees a team of analysts or proposal writers. Strong project management, communication, and analytical skills are essential in this position.

How does a Director RFP Analyst typically collaborate with other departments during the proposal process?

A Director RFP Analyst works closely with cross-functional teams such as sales, legal, finance, and subject matter experts to develop comprehensive and competitive proposals. They coordinate input from these departments to ensure that all technical, pricing, and compliance aspects are accurately addressed in response to client requirements. This collaboration often involves leading meetings, establishing timelines, and ensuring clear communication across all stakeholders to meet strict submission deadlines. Effective teamwork and project management skills are essential, as the quality of the final RFP response often relies on seamless interdepartmental cooperation.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Director RFP Analyst,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Director RFP Analyst, you need expertise in proposal management, strategic analysis, and a deep understanding of industry-specific regulations, usually backed by a bachelor's degree and significant experience in RFP processes. Familiarity with RFP management software, CRM systems, and advanced Excel or data analysis tools is typically required. Excellent leadership, communication, and project management skills help in coordinating cross-functional teams and delivering persuasive, client-focused proposals. These skills ensure the effective creation of competitive bids, drive business growth, and maintain strong client relationships in a highly competitive environment.

The Part Time RFP Writer manages proposal responses for public-sector and non-ERISA retirement plans (403(b), 457(b), FICA Alternative), focusing on annuity and fixed-account solutions. This role requires proposal management experience within the financial, retirement, or investment sectors.
Your specific duties will include:

  • Draft, edit, format, and assemble comprehensive responses to RFPs, RFIs, and RFQs (including 403(b), 457(b), and FICA Alternative/3121 opportunities).
  • Review complex procurement instructions, identify deadlines, outline response requirements, and assist with go/no-go evaluations.
  • Develop compliance matrices, proposal drafts, required forms, questionnaires, and all supporting submission documents.
  • Collaborate with internal teams (Sales, Product, Legal, Compliance, Operations, Investments, and Marketing) to gather inputs while managing strict project timelines.
  • Maintain, refresh, and optimize RFP databases (e.g., Loopio) with compliance-approved language, product positioning, and standard company descriptions.
  • Manage Salesforce/CRM updates, track win/loss statistics, and provide periodic reporting on RFP volume, seasonal trends, and proposal outcomes.
  • Support internal platform provider RFPs, scoring templates, and comparison matrices as needed.


Required qualifications for the position include :

  • Prior experience in writing and coordinating RFPs in retirement, investment management, or financial services.
  • Knowledge of public-sector retirement markets and related products (annuities, stable value, fixed accounts).
  • Strong writing, editing, proofreading, and project management skills.
  • Ability to interpret complex procurement rules and work independently in a remote/hybrid setup.
  • Experience using RFP database platforms (Loopio, Responsive, Qvidian, etc.).


Preferred qualifications for the position include:

  • Knowledge of public-sector procurement processes, school district RFPs, and non-ERISA plan sponsor evaluation criteria.
  • Experience preparing executive summaries, pricing exhibits, implementation plans, and finalist presentation materials.
  • Familiarity with Salesforce or similar CRM systems.
  • Ability to analyze RFP data to prepare concise strategic reporting for business leadership.
